LU-6245 libcfs: cleanup list handling
For the kernel space side we should use list.h directly expect in the case of kernel API changes that impact us then we use linux-list.h that handles those API changes. A few of the user land utilities use a list implementation so we provide a separate list implementation for the libcfs library. Signed-off-by:James Simmons <uja.ornl@yahoo.com> Change-Id: I1280d74a629dbaa9c11a3c506fd635fab99ce182 Reviewed-on: http://review.whamcloud.com/15200 Tested-by: Jenkins Tested-by:
Maloo <hpdd-maloo@intel.com> Reviewed-by:
Dmitry Eremin <dmitry.eremin@intel.com> Reviewed-by:
John L. Hammond <john.hammond@intel.com> Reviewed-by:
Oleg Drokin <oleg.drokin@intel.com>
Showing
- libcfs/include/libcfs/Makefile.am 0 additions, 1 deletionlibcfs/include/libcfs/Makefile.am
- libcfs/include/libcfs/libcfs.h 0 additions, 2 deletionslibcfs/include/libcfs/libcfs.h
- libcfs/include/libcfs/linux/Makefile.am 1 addition, 1 deletionlibcfs/include/libcfs/linux/Makefile.am
- libcfs/include/libcfs/linux/linux-list.h 52 additions, 0 deletionslibcfs/include/libcfs/linux/linux-list.h
- libcfs/include/libcfs/util/Makefile.am 1 addition, 1 deletionlibcfs/include/libcfs/util/Makefile.am
- libcfs/include/libcfs/util/list.h 3 additions, 33 deletionslibcfs/include/libcfs/util/list.h
- libcfs/include/libcfs/util/string.h 1 addition, 1 deletionlibcfs/include/libcfs/util/string.h
- libcfs/libcfs/hash.c 1 addition, 0 deletionslibcfs/libcfs/hash.c
- lnet/utils/cyaml/cyaml.c 1 addition, 1 deletionlnet/utils/cyaml/cyaml.c
- lnet/utils/lst.c 1 addition, 1 deletionlnet/utils/lst.c
- lustre/include/lu_ref.h 1 addition, 1 deletionlustre/include/lu_ref.h
- lustre/include/lustre_disk.h 5 additions, 0 deletionslustre/include/lustre_disk.h
- lustre/ldlm/ldlm_flock.c 1 addition, 1 deletionlustre/ldlm/ldlm_flock.c
- lustre/ldlm/ldlm_lockd.c 1 addition, 1 deletionlustre/ldlm/ldlm_lockd.c
- lustre/lfsck/lfsck_lib.c 1 addition, 1 deletionlustre/lfsck/lfsck_lib.c
- lustre/obdclass/cl_io.c 1 addition, 1 deletionlustre/obdclass/cl_io.c
- lustre/obdclass/cl_lock.c 1 addition, 1 deletionlustre/obdclass/cl_lock.c
- lustre/obdclass/cl_object.c 1 addition, 1 deletionlustre/obdclass/cl_object.c
- lustre/obdclass/cl_page.c 1 addition, 1 deletionlustre/obdclass/cl_page.c
- lustre/obdclass/class_obd.c 1 addition, 1 deletionlustre/obdclass/class_obd.c
Loading
Please register or sign in to comment